Handles the transmission of … Web4 feb. 2024 · TCP/IP has four layers. OSI model, the transport layer is only connection-oriented. A layer of the TCP/IP model is both connection-oriented and connectionless. In the OSI model, the data link layer and physical are separate layers. In TCP, physical and data link are both combined as a single host-to-network layer. WebThe Open Systems Interconnection reference model is used to define how data communications occurs on computer networks. It is divided into 7 layers, each of which provide services to adjacent layers and are associated with protocols and devices.
